mmcterm

Terminal for the custom "serial over IPMB" protocol used by DMMC-STAMP.

Installation

pip3 install mmcterm

Usage

mmcterm [-h] [-v] [-c CHANNEL] [-t INTERVAL] [-l] [-d] [-i] [-m MAX_PKT_SIZE] [--vadatech-quirk] mch_addr mmc_addr
DESY MMC Serial over IPMB console
positional arguments:
mch_addr IP address or hostname of MCH
mmc_addr IPMB-L address of MMC or "AMCn" (n=1..12)
options:
-h, --help show this help message and exit
-v, --version show program's version number and exit
-c CHANNEL, --channel CHANNEL
console channel (default 0)
-t INTERVAL, --interval INTERVAL
polling interval in ms (default 10)
-l, --list list available channels
-d, --debug pyipmi debug mode
-i, --ipmitool make pyipmi use ipmitool instead of native rmcp
-m MAX_PKT_SIZE, --max-pkt-size MAX_PKT_SIZE
max IPMB packet size to use (Higher numbers give better performance, but can break depending on MCH model)
--vadatech-quirk Enable ipmi library quirk for Vadatech support (ignore req seq numbers)

Channels

The DMMC-STAMP always provides channel 0 for the MMC console. This is also the default channel, if the -c argument is not given to mmcterm. Depending on the board implementation, there can be up to 2 additional channels for UARTs of payload FPGAs. The presence and names of those channels can be queried with the -l argument.

Note that only one channel can be opened to a MMC at the same time.

Example

Open a console on AMC board at IPMB address 0x7a connected to the MCH mskmchhvf1.tech.lab:

mmcterm mskmchhvf1.tech.lab 0x7a

Max packet size

Without the -m option, mmcterm uses the standard maximum IPMB packet size of 32 bytes. Due to the limitations of the IPMI protocol, this can quickly become a bottleneck, esp. when used with a SoC running Linux. To mitigate this bottleneck, bigger packet sizes can be set with -m. For NAT MCHs, -m 100 was found to be working, even though it is more than 3 times the standard packet size.

Protocol description

"Serial over IPMB" is a lightweight "serial data forwarding" protocol using custom IPMI messages.

Get channel info

NetFn 0x30, Command 0xf0

Request:

ByteContents
0Channel Number

Response:

ByteContents
0..nChannel Name

Start/stop SOI session

NetFn 0x30, Command 0xf1

Request:

ByteContents
0Channel Number
11 = start, 0 = stop
2Max packet size (optional)

Poll/exchange data

NetFn 0x30, Command 0xf2

Request:

ByteContents
0..nSend data from terminal to MMC

Response:

ByteContents
0..nReceive data from MMC to terminal
